go语言和python哪个简单

三金网

在编程语言的选择上,Go语言和Python各有千秋。随着科技的不断发展,越来越多的人开始学习编程,而选择一门简单易学的语言尤为重要。本文将围绕Go语言与Python的简单性进行对比,帮助您做出更合适的选择。

go语言和python哪个简单图1

首先,我们来看看Python。这是一种高级的、解释型的编程语言,因其语法简洁明了而备受欢迎。Python的设计理念强调代码的可读性,使得即便是没有编程基础的初学者也能快速上手。Python的社区非常活跃,有大量的现成库和框架可供使用,这进一步降低了编程的门槛。在中国,许多学校和培训机构也将Python作为编程入门的首选语言,课程内容丰富,资源广泛。

Python的应用领域非常广泛,包括数据分析、机器学习、网页开发、自动化脚本等。比如,在数据科学领域,许多大型企业和科研机构都使用Python进行数据分析。这也就意味着,如果你掌握了Python,能够在这方面找到较多的就业机会,尤其是在快速发展的人工智能行业。

go语言和python哪个简单图2

接下来,我们再来看Go语言。Go语言是由谷歌开发的一种编译型语言,以其高效的性能和并发处理能力受到广泛关注。与Python相比,Go语言的语法相对简单,不过可能在初学时稍显陌生。例如,Go语言对类型的严格要求和需要的结构体定义,可能会让一些初学者感到困惑。

尽管Go语言较新的特性可能使其学习曲线稍微陡峭,但它在处理并发任务时表现非常出色,这使得它在网络编程、云计算等领域得到了广泛应用。如果你的目标是进行高性能的服务器开发,学习Go语言将是一个明智的选择。

在中国,Go语言也逐渐得到了重视,尤其是在互联网公司中,很多企业开始使用Go开发高性能的后端系统。这意味着,从事相关工作的程序员将会面临越来越多的Go语言的需求。

简单性方面,Python通常被认为比Go更易于学习和使用。Python的语法设计便于阅读,内置了大量实用库,帮助开发者更快速地实现功能。而Go语言则更注重程序的性能、并发性的管理,虽然在结构化编程方面有其优越性,但初学者可能需要更长的时间去掌握这些概念。

go语言和python哪个简单图3

当然,简单性不仅仅体现在语言的语法上,还包括学习资源的可得性。Python在这方面明显占优,网络上有大量教程、视频和论坛供学习者参考。相比之下,Go语言的学习资源相对欠缺,虽然近年来已经开始增多,但仍然不及Python丰富。

综上所述,若您是编程初学者,希望快速上手、实现简单功能,Python无疑是更为适合的选择;而如果您希望在技术深度和程序性能上有所突破,且需要处理高并发的业务场景,Go语言则值得您去探索。

最终,选择哪种语言还要结合个人需求和职业发展方向。如果您有兴趣在数据科学或者人工智能领域发展,Python是个不错的起步;若希望进入高性能服务器开发或者云计算领域,Go语言也是个很好的选择。无论如何,两者都有其独特的优势,各具特色。希望每位读者都能找到最适合自己的编程语言,开启编程之旅。